Transaction ef92b0756f5a531c173f524b038a40554e6a2be90681a9b4a7fb4db09378d87e
1 Input
1 Output
-
ef92b0756f5a531c173f524b038a40554e6a2be90681a9b4a7fb4db09378d87e:0
- value
- 931839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d993324bbb11a0228965209a93440fc26b3da836 OP_EQUAL
- address
- 3MXStZUxy97WizxMuqvBAAi3RGcvLQwo8P